Childcare costs in Campbell
ChildCare Aware reports the Nebraska average full-time cost at $970/month for infant care and $720/month for preschool. City-level prices in Campbell vary by ZIP code and program model — Head Start sites are free for eligible families, family daycare homes typically run 10-30% below center rates, and accredited centers run above the average.
The Child & Dependent Care Tax Credit and a Dependent Care FSA ($5,000 max) reduce effective cost regardless of program. Nebraska families may also qualify for Nebraska Child Care Subsidy Program (intake: (800) 383-4278).
